QR Codes

QR codes were originally invented in Japan as a way to track machine parts but recently they have been adapted to contain all kinds of information that can be scanned by smartphones and specific action can be taken. In the case of GroupDeal, when your customers print out the coupons it will include a QR code which when the merchant scans it will connect to your website and instruct it that the coupon has been used. If the person tries to use the coupon again it will tell the merchant that the coupon is no longer valid.

This quick scanning method will help keep down the inevitable queues that will form from all the people using their coupons and is a much quicker way of trying to match up individual codes from the backup sheet of paper they can print out.
